OYO Parent Oravel Stays Renamed Prism Amid Global Expansion

OYO's parent company, Oravel Stays Limited, has rebranded itself as PRISM to reflect its expanded global portfolio and long-term strategic vision. PRISM will serve as the umbrella brand for the company's diverse businesses, including technology solutions, premium hospitality, extended-stay residences, celebration venues, and experiential living concepts, while the OYO brand will remain the consumer-facing identity for budget and midscale travel. Founded in 2012 by Ritesh Agarwal, who remains the chairman and group CEO, the company has grown into a diversified global travel-tech and hospitality ecosystem serving over 100 million customers across more than 35 countries. PRISM's portfolio includes hotel brands such as OYO, Motel 6, Townhouse, Sunday, and Palette, vacation home brands like Belvilla and DanCenter, and extended-stay residences under Studio 6. The rebranding followed a global public naming competition with over 6,000 entries and aims to create a future-ready corporate architecture powered by technology, data science, and AI to drive profitable growth and better partner collaboration. Agarwal emphasized that this transition clarifies the company's identity while uniting its various brands without losing their uniqueness.
